Bangladesh Army on Sunday hosted an iftar and dinner party at Sena Malancha in Dhaka Cantonment in honour of the students injured during the July uprising.
Chief of Army Staff General Waker-Uz-Zaman exchanged greetings with the injured students and inquired about their well-being during the event.

The gathering was attended by the injured students, senior army officers, prominent civilians, and directors of various government hospitals.
Later, the Bangladesh Army presented Eid gifts to the students.

To date, 4,215 people injured in the July Uprising have received medical care at various Combined Military Hospitals (CMHs) across the country, with 989 undergoing successful surgeries.
Currently, 39 injured are receiving treatment at CMH in Dhaka.
